Thai logistics firm in hot water as labour exploitation claims posted

A prominent private logistics company has been forced to navigate emerging challenges, as allegations of labour exploitation surge. A post from the Riders Union page highlighted the plight of the company’s employees, who face drastic cuts in their commission rates and are expected to deliver up to 200 to 500 parcels a day without overtime pay.

 

The post alleged…

 

“Employees have resigned nationwide due to reduced commissions. Some have seen their earnings plummet from 8,000 baht to less than 500 baht.”

 

The post further claimed that a new company policy requires employees to deliver 300 to 500 parcels per day, with commission paid only for 40 to 80 of those deliveries.

 

These labour exploitation allegations have led to a growing discontent among the workforce, with many employees choosing to resign. The disgruntled former employees have taken to social media to air their grievances, causing reputational damage to the company.
